Located in the cul-de-sac of Hellidon Close, Leamington Spa, is this beautifully presented Two Double Bedroom Mid-Terrace home briefly comprising: Entrance Hall, Through Lounge with Dining Area, Kitchen, Two Good Size Bedrooms, Dressing Room and Family Bathroom upstairs. Outside, there is a Double Width Driveway and to the rear is a Well Presented Rear Garden.
